PowerBall Jackpot Hits $425 million

The next Powerball drawing will be held on August 7. What would you do if you won?

After a long string of drawings without a winner, the Powerball jackpot has increased to $425 million, making it the fourth-largest U.S. jackpot.

The prize has a $244.7 million cash option. The next drawing will be held Wednesday, Aug. 7.

During last Saturday's drawing, a Milpitas woman Lea Yaneza won $1,159,103 in prize money.

"I checked the website and at first I thought I matched three numbers. I was jumping up and down, then I realized I matched five," Yaneza said. "I checked over and over, I just couldn’t believe what I was seeing."

Yaneza plans to pay for her kids' educations and buy herself a house.
